In Season 1, Episode 3 of The Way of the Psychonaut: Extended Interviews, psychotherapist and MAPS founder Rick Doblin discusses the landmark 1962 study and its lasting implications for modern therapy.
This extended interview dives deep into the intersection of psilocybin research and consciousness, exploring how clinical settings can facilitate a genuine psychedelic Mystical Experience. Doblin shares his analysis of the Walter Pahnke Good Friday experiment, detailing how researchers first sought to scientifically measure spiritual states. He examines the connection between a Mystical Experience psilocybin can induce and its therapeutic application for those processing deep psychological trauma. Through his work with MAPS, Doblin has spent decades advocating for the clinical study of Psychedelics and spiritual experiences, aiming to establish a balanced framework for healing.
Doblin also reflects on his personal journey, including his extensive study of Holotropic Breathwork under Stanislav Grof. This practice, which utilizes deep, rapid breathing to access non-ordinary states of consciousness, provides a crucial parallel to psychedelic therapy. By comparing these modalities, Doblin illustrates how the human mind possesses an inherent capacity for self-healing when provided with the proper set, setting, and support. His insights offer a grounded perspective on how the science of psychedelic states can be applied practically to address modern mental health crises, moving beyond historical stigma to embrace rigorous clinical inquiry.
